5f Prix de l’Abbaye de Longchamp Longines (Group 1)

Glass Slippers ran out a surprise 20/1 winner of the Abbaye last year in similar conditions from stall 3. That wasn’t the strongest looking renewal with Battash bombing out and the form of that race hasn’t looked great this year either.

Glass Slippers does come into this race off the back of a very good winning performance in the Group 1 Flying Five Stakes over at the Curragh three weeks ago, but 9/4 looks short enough for a race that often throws up a few surprises.

I’d probably pick out Make A Challenge from the Flying Five Stakes given he was drawn miles away from the pace and made up a lot of lengths on Glass Slippers and Keep Busy on ground faster than ideal. Make A Challenge has unfortunately been drawn widest again, but can go close if getting a better run.

AIR DE VALSE put in a commanding performance and her best career run to date over course and distance in the Group 3 Prix du Petit Couvert a few weeks ago. She ran the fastest ever time in the race and came close to breaking the course record.

She has proven herself over softer conditions and has seemed to get better and better with racing this season.

Air De Valse does need to step up again, but she beat the Prix Jean Prat fourth Wooded pretty comfortably on her last start and ran well behind pattern-level performer Breathtaking Look the time before.

Air De Valse’s odds of 12/1 look big for a filly that deserves to have her first start in a Group 1 and she’s worth a punt.
